The Republic of Haiti is a tropical Caribbean country located south of Cuba and west of the Dominican Republic. The most mountainous country in the Caribbean, Haiti has stunning landscapes and views, along with natural coasts and beaches. The population is young, with 50 percent of Haiti’s 11.2 million people under the age of 23. Haitians predominantly speak French and Creole, and are largely Roman Catholic and Protestant while practicing some elements of locally recognized Vodou.
